Turtle Cheesecake Hobo Pies

An easy pie iron dessert filled with caramel, chocolate, cinnamon pecans and cream cheese that's cooked over the campfire.

Ingredients

  • 2 refrigerated pie crusts
  • 1/2 cup semi sweet chocolate chips
  • 4 tbsp whipped cream cheese
  • 2 tbsp butter, (optional)
  • 12 pieces caramel, halved or quartered
  • 1/2 cup sugar coated cinnamon pecans

Instructions

  • Spray both side of the inside of the pie iron with cooking spray.
  • Unroll the pie crusts and cut each one into four pieces. (You may have some excess dough which you could use to form together to make a 5th pie.)
  • Spread butter on one side of the pie crust dough (optional) and place the pie crust butter side down into the pie iron.
  • Spread the cream cheese on the inside of the first piece of pie crust dough. Add chocolate chips, pieces of caramel and cinnamon pecans.
  • Top with another piece of pie crust. Spread butter on top (optional).
  • Close up pie iron and cook over the fire or hot coals for approximately 15 minutes, flipping halfway through.
